Antonio Brown involved in huge fight after boxing event

Former NFL wide receiver Antonio Brown was briefly handcuffed Friday night after being involved in a huge fight after an Adin Ross kickboxing event.

Multiple videos emerged on social media showing Brown involved in a huge fight following the event in Miami, Fl. Video obtained by TMZ showed that Brown was initially tackled to the ground by unidentified individuals, prompting him to begin kicking one of his assailants.

There were also reports of shots fired during the incident. Allegedly, they may have been fired by Brown, who was alleged to have had a gun, though this is not confirmed.

Initial reports suggested that Brown was arrested at the scene. Brown later clarified on X that he was “jumped by multiple individuals who tried to steal my jewelry and cause physical harm to me.” He was handcuffed, but was only detained temporarily while police tried to piece together what happened.

Brown said he plans to pursue legal action against the individuals who allegedly attacked him.

Brown’s account was largely confirmed by Miami police, who told TMZ that no arrests were made and there were no reports of injuries. An investigation is ongoing.

Brown last appeared in the NFL in 2021 with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, but his NFL career is fundamentally over. As of last year, he was facing significant financial issues. This is not his first brush with the law, either.
